It’s finally here, a Jailbreak method for your iPhone, iPod Touch, iPad and iPad mini. This jailbreak supports iOS 6.0 – 6.1.2. This means that your iPhone 3GS, iPhone 4, iPhone 4s, iPhone 5, iPod 4, iPod 5, iPad 2, iPad 3, iPad 4 and even the iPad mini can all be Jailbroken. And best of all, it’s free and incredibly easy to Jailbreak.
The brilliant developers over at Evad3rs have finally released their jailbreak for all devices running iOS 6 & iOS 6.0 – 6.1.2. Evad3rs calls their jailbreak “Evasi0n”.
For those that don’t know, jailbreaking your device opens it up to a multitude of new possibilities, from completely changing the look, adding avatars/faces to your contacts, even down to turning your device into a working Gameboy.
I have to commend the developers for making it so incredibly simple to Jailbreak. The entire process is pretty much carried out with the click of 1 button. The Evasi0n app automatically recognizes the device you have plugged into your computer, all that’s left is to click the “Jailbreak” button.
A few things to do before Jailbreaking
This of course all sounds great, but before you rush to the Evasi0n site there are a few thing you should do.
- Make sure you have iOS 6.0 – 6.1.2 installed on your iOS device. Check your version by going to Setting -> General -> About -> Version. Update if necessary.
- Backup your device first, either to iCloud or iTunes
- Disable the passcode on your device. This can be done by going to Settings -> General -> Passcode Lock – > “Turn Passcode Off”. Leaving the passcode on can cause errors.
- DO NOT sync your device with iTunes while you are Jailbreaking. It fact do yourself a favour and close out iTunes to prevent it from deciding to sync by itself.
- If you get an error on Mac OS X 10.8 saying that Evasi0n can’t be opened, control-click (or right-click) the app and on the revealed context menu, choose ‘Open.’ On the ensuing dialogue box, choose ‘Open’ as well.
Jailbreaking the iOS device
You really don’t need instructions to install it since it’s so simple, however I’ll include the steps anyways. Download the Evasi0n jailbreaking application, plug your device into your computer. Open Evasion, click the “Jailbreak” button. Through the process you may be asked by the app to open the Evasi0n app on your device to finalize everything.
Also during the process, it may appear that the jailbreak progress has frozen. Be patient, this is normal, it could take anywhere from 5-10 minutes, let it do its thing.
If the jailbreaking process does actually freeze however, you can safely restart the device (turn off then on), and then simply re-run Evasi0n again once it’s restarted.
Once the jailbreak is complete Cydia will be accessible on your iOS device.
